#ba699d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#ba699d is composed of 72.9% red, 41.2%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 43.5% magenta, 15.6%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 321.5 degrees, a saturation of 37% and a lightness of 57.1%. #ba699d color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d2ff with #75003b.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

#ba699d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#ba699d has RGB values of R:186, G:105, B:157 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.44, Y:0.16,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 12216733.

Shades and Tints of #ba699d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0509 is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#ba699d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#988b93 is the less saturated color, while #fd26b0 is the most saturated one.
